Comprehending the Ram Engine Lineup
Before acquiring parts, one must recognize the specific engine powering the lorry. Over the decades, Buy Dodge Ram Truck Engine and Ram have actually used a number of engine architectures, each with unique part requirements.
1. The 5.7 L Hemi V8
Maybe the most famous engine in the lineup, the Hemi is known for its hemispherical combustion chambers. While powerful, it needs specific components like distinct trigger plug setups (often 16 plugs for 8 cylinders) and specialized lifters.
2. The 6.7 L Cummins Turbo Diesel
Found in Heavy Duty (2500 and 3500) designs, the Cummins is a straight-six powerhouse. Parts for these engines, such as fuel injectors and turbochargers, are frequently more pricey but built for severe longevity.
3. The 3.6 L Pentastar V6
Frequently discovered in the Ram 1500, this engine concentrates on fuel performance. It makes use of a double overhead camera (DOHC) style, requiring specific timing chain sets and oil filter housings.

In the United States, the most accurate method to guarantee a part fits a Dodge Ram is by using the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). The VIN is a 17-digit code found on the driver-side dashboard or the door jamb sticker label.

Expert parts databases in the USA use the VIN to filter out parts that might look identical but have minor variations based on the develop date or trim level. This is especially essential for Ram trucks, as mid-year production changes prevail, especially relating to electrical adapters and cooling system hosing.

Why are Cummins diesel motor parts more costly than Hemi parts?
Diesel engines run under much higher compression and heat. Subsequently, the products used for Cummins parts need to be more resilient and are crafted to tighter tolerances, resulting in greater production expenses.
2. Can I utilize a Ram 1500 engine part on a Ram 2500?
Not necessarily. While they may share the 5.7 L Hemi engine, the 2500 series often uses different cooling systems, heavier-duty generators, and various exhaust manifolds to accommodate the larger frame.
3. What is the "Hemi Tick," and which parts fix it?
The "Hemi Tick" is typically triggered by failed manifold bolts or lifter/camshaft wear. To repair it, owners usually need to purchase updated exhaust manifold bolts or a complete camshaft and lifter replacement kit.
4. Is it safe to buy "utilized" engine parts from a salvage lawn?
For non-wear products like consumption manifolds or engine brackets, utilized parts can save cash. However, for internal components like pistons, bearings, or sensors, purchasing brand-new is constantly recommended to guarantee longevity.
